Eastern & Oriental Express

 

Board the luxury train from Bangkok to Singapore with Eastern & Oriental Express.

Combine the bustle of the big city with the restorative calm of the countryside. Following a stay in Bangkok, board the green and gold carriages of the Eastern & Oriental Express. Travel through Thailand with a stop at the infamous River Kwai, featuring a fascinating tour of the bridge’s history. Journey onward through Malaysia and unearth the secrets of Kuala Kangsar, a royal town brimming with history. Arriving in Singapore, explore this breathtaking ‘garden city’ that beguiles with its architecture and cosmopolitan bustle. 

Day 1: Bangkok:

Stewards in traditional silk uniforms greet you as you join the Eastern & Oriental Express prior to its departure in the early evening. Dinner is served as the train travels from the city into the countryside with its rice-fields, villages and water buffalo. 

Day 2: Kanchanaburi & River Kwai:

Awake early in order not to miss the excitement of the train making its way from Wang Po along the wooden trestle viaduct beside a towering cliff. On arrival at the River Kwai Bridge station, we disembark for your choice of excursion. Cruise along the Khwae Yai River Tour, Tracks to Unseen Thailand Tour or Local Flavours Tour of Thailand wet market.

Day 3: Kuala Kangsar – Kuala Lumpur.:

Awake to breakfast in bed as the train travels through the picturesque countryside of Malaysia. Brunch is served before arrival into Kuala Kangsar and alight to board a coach. Travel to a rural village set among the rice paddies and surrounded by hills and mountains. Here you have two excursions to choose from, Traditional Village Experience or Hill Trek. 

Day 4: Johor – Singapore:

After breakfast, having crossed the Straits of Johor into Singapore, the journey ends.
